System Design For Data Science Interviews thumbnail

System Design For Data Science Interviews

Published Nov 29, 24
7 min read

What is very important in the above curve is that Degeneration gives a higher worth for Info Gain and thus cause more splitting compared to Gini. When a Choice Tree isn't intricate enough, a Random Forest is normally used (which is absolutely nothing even more than multiple Choice Trees being grown on a subset of the information and a last majority voting is done).

The number of clusters are established utilizing an elbow joint curve. The variety of collections may or might not be very easy to find (particularly if there isn't a clear kink on the curve). Additionally, understand that the K-Means algorithm maximizes in your area and not worldwide. This indicates that your clusters will depend upon your initialization worth.

For even more details on K-Means and other forms of without supervision learning algorithms, have a look at my various other blog site: Clustering Based Unsupervised Knowing Neural Network is one of those neologism formulas that everyone is looking in the direction of nowadays. While it is not feasible for me to cover the complex details on this blog, it is very important to understand the basic systems along with the idea of back propagation and vanishing gradient.

If the instance study need you to develop an expository version, either select a different design or be prepared to discuss just how you will certainly locate exactly how the weights are adding to the outcome (e.g. the visualization of covert layers during image acknowledgment). Finally, a solitary model may not precisely figure out the target.

For such situations, an ensemble of multiple designs are utilized. One of the most common means of reviewing design efficiency is by computing the percentage of documents whose records were predicted properly.

When our design is also complicated (e.g.

High variance because difference result will VARY will certainly we randomize the training data (information the model is version very stableReally. Currently, in order to identify the version's intricacy, we make use of a learning contour as revealed listed below: On the understanding contour, we vary the train-test split on the x-axis and compute the accuracy of the design on the training and recognition datasets.

Interviewbit For Data Science Practice

Faang Interview Preparation CourseReal-world Scenarios For Mock Data Science Interviews


The further the curve from this line, the greater the AUC and better the model. The highest possible a design can get is an AUC of 1, where the curve develops an ideal tilted triangle. The ROC curve can additionally assist debug a version. If the lower left edge of the contour is better to the arbitrary line, it indicates that the version is misclassifying at Y=0.

Additionally, if there are spikes on the contour (rather than being smooth), it implies the design is not steady. When managing fraud models, ROC is your finest pal. For even more information review Receiver Operating Attribute Curves Demystified (in Python).

Data scientific research is not just one area but a collection of fields made use of with each other to build something special. Information scientific research is simultaneously mathematics, statistics, problem-solving, pattern searching for, communications, and business. Due to how broad and interconnected the field of information science is, taking any kind of action in this field might appear so complicated and complex, from trying to learn your way through to job-hunting, searching for the right function, and ultimately acing the meetings, but, in spite of the complexity of the field, if you have clear steps you can comply with, getting involved in and getting a task in information science will not be so confusing.

Information scientific research is everything about maths and stats. From likelihood concept to linear algebra, maths magic allows us to recognize information, locate fads and patterns, and develop formulas to predict future information scientific research (Exploring Machine Learning for Data Science Roles). Math and stats are crucial for data scientific research; they are always asked regarding in data science interviews

All skills are used daily in every information scientific research job, from information collection to cleaning to expedition and analysis. As quickly as the recruiter tests your capacity to code and consider the different algorithmic issues, they will provide you data science problems to test your data managing abilities. You often can pick Python, R, and SQL to clean, discover and assess a given dataset.

Engineering Manager Behavioral Interview Questions

Maker knowing is the core of many information science applications. Although you may be creating artificial intelligence formulas just occasionally on the task, you need to be extremely comfy with the standard device finding out algorithms. On top of that, you require to be able to recommend a machine-learning formula based upon a particular dataset or a specific trouble.

Outstanding sources, including 100 days of artificial intelligence code infographics, and going through an artificial intelligence issue. Validation is just one of the primary actions of any information science task. Ensuring that your design acts appropriately is crucial for your companies and clients because any type of mistake may create the loss of cash and sources.

, and standards for A/B tests. In enhancement to the concerns about the certain building blocks of the field, you will always be asked basic data science concerns to examine your ability to put those building obstructs with each other and develop a full project.

Some excellent resources to go through are 120 data scientific research interview inquiries, and 3 types of information science meeting inquiries. The data science job-hunting process is just one of one of the most tough job-hunting refines out there. Seeking job functions in information science can be tough; one of the major reasons is the ambiguity of the function titles and summaries.

This uncertainty only makes preparing for the interview also more of a trouble. Exactly how can you prepare for an obscure role? By practising the basic building blocks of the field and after that some basic questions concerning the different algorithms, you have a durable and powerful combination ensured to land you the work.

Obtaining ready for data scientific research meeting questions is, in some aspects, no different than preparing for an interview in any kind of various other market.!?"Information researcher interviews consist of a lot of technological subjects.

Using Pramp For Advanced Data Science Practice

This can consist of a phone interview, Zoom interview, in-person meeting, and panel interview. As you might anticipate, several of the interview inquiries will concentrate on your hard skills. You can additionally anticipate inquiries about your soft skills, in addition to behavioral interview inquiries that assess both your difficult and soft abilities.

Mock Interview CodingSystem Design Course


Technical skills aren't the only kind of information science meeting concerns you'll encounter. Like any interview, you'll likely be asked behavioral inquiries.

Below are 10 behavior inquiries you could experience in a data researcher meeting: Tell me concerning a time you utilized data to produce change at a job. Have you ever before needed to describe the technological information of a task to a nontechnical individual? Just how did you do it? What are your hobbies and interests beyond data science? Inform me about a time when you worked on a long-term data project.



Understand the various sorts of interviews and the general process. Study stats, likelihood, theory testing, and A/B screening. Master both basic and sophisticated SQL inquiries with practical problems and mock meeting inquiries. Use essential collections like Pandas, NumPy, Matplotlib, and Seaborn for information control, evaluation, and basic machine discovering.

Hi, I am presently preparing for an information science meeting, and I have actually encountered an instead challenging concern that I can use some aid with - Preparing for the Unexpected in Data Science Interviews. The inquiry involves coding for an information scientific research problem, and I think it needs some innovative abilities and techniques.: Offered a dataset including information about customer demographics and acquisition background, the job is to anticipate whether a client will certainly buy in the next month

Advanced Techniques For Data Science Interview Success

You can not perform that action at this time.

The demand for information scientists will expand in the coming years, with a projected 11.5 million job openings by 2026 in the United States alone. The field of data science has actually quickly gotten appeal over the past years, and therefore, competition for data science jobs has actually ended up being tough. Wondering 'Just how to get ready for information scientific research interview'? Continue reading to locate the response! Source: Online Manipal Examine the work listing thoroughly. Check out the firm's official website. Assess the rivals in the industry. Comprehend the company's worths and society. Examine the company's latest success. Discover regarding your potential interviewer. Prior to you study, you must understand there are specific kinds of interviews to prepare for: Interview TypeDescriptionCoding InterviewsThis interview evaluates knowledge of various topics, consisting of machine understanding methods, sensible information removal and adjustment obstacles, and computer technology principles.

Latest Posts

Statistics For Data Science

Published Dec 23, 24
2 min read

Common Pitfalls In Data Science Interviews

Published Dec 23, 24
3 min read